Setup
-
Flight controller: CubePilot Cube Orange Plus
-
Autopilot: PX4 v1.16.0
-
Companion: Jetson Orin NX 16 GB on Seeed reComputer A603
-
OS/SDK: JetPack 6.2 (Ubuntu 22.04)
-
Tools available: QGroundControl, MAVProxy, mavlink-router, PyMAVLink, Micro XRCE-DDS Agent v2.4.2
-
Wiring (A603 W8 ↔ TELEM2, 3.3 V TTL):
-
A603 pin 8 (UART1_TX) → TELEM2 pin 3 (RX)
-
A603 pin 10 (UART1_RX) ← TELEM2 pin 2 (TX)
-
GND ↔ GND (TELEM2 pin 6)
-
(Also tried RTS/CTS on A603 pin 11 ↔ TELEM2 CTS and A603 pin 36 ↔ TELEM2 RTS)
-
Goal / Modes
-
MAVLink over TELEM2 → Jetson
MAV_1_CONFIG=TELEM2
,SER_TEL2_BAUD=230400
and921600
,MAV_1_MODE=Onboard
,UXRCE_DDS_CFG=Disabled
-
uXRCE-DDS over TELEM2 → Jetson
MAV_1_CONFIG=Disabled
,UXRCE_DDS_CFG=TELEM2
, same baud rates; Jetson runsMicroXRCEAgent serial -D <port> -b <baud>
What works (baseline)
-
Using a USB-to-TTL 3.3 V dongle on Cube TELEM2 (→
/dev/ttyUSB*
), both MAVLink and uXRCE-DDS work at 230400 and 921600. -
This working case uses only GND, TX, RX (no RTS/CTS).
What doesn’t work
-
Using the A603 40-pin header UART on the Jetson (expected
/dev/ttyTHS1
), I get no data. -
Already disabled
serial-getty@ttyTHS1.service
andModemManager
. -
Tried line settings with and without HW flow control, e.g.:
stty -F /dev/ttyTHS1 230400 cs8 -cstopb -parenb -ixon -ixoff -crtscts stty -F /dev/ttyTHS1 921600 cs8 -cstopb -parenb -ixon -ixoff -crtscts
-
Raw reads show nothing; moving the exact same TELEM2 cable back to a USB-UART dongle works immediately.
